Who is a Chef?

The word "chef" is derived (and shortened) from the term chef de cuisine (the director or head of a kitchen.) Typically, a chef oversees the kitchen to include the menu planning, pricing, food preparation, supplies, quality of service, safety, and staff. They ensure the meals are cooked and seasoned properly and that they are pleasing to the eye.

What does a Chef Do?

A kitchen typically follows a well-defined organizational structure, the chef being the head. So anyone pursuing the career of a chef will have to hold different roles during the process and each require different skills. Here is a summary of all the tasks that one would cover across stages.

Kitchen Title and Levels

Executive Chef

Large establishments have an executive chef who is responsible for the operation of multiple outlets. It is primarily a management role and thus they do very little actual cooking!
